— The following body swaps occurred: * Rachel and Tina * Kurt and Finn * Puck and Blaine * Santana and Artie * Brittany and Mercedes * Quinn and Sugar * Sam and Rory * Mike and Joe * Sue and Will — This is the first episode where Tina is prominently featured. — This episode's recap is almost 50 seconds long, the longest in the series. It mainly focuses on the neglect of Tina in the past three seasons. — This is the first episode since A Night of Neglect (02x17) to feature a solo by Tina, a gap of 25 episodes. — Nationals (03x21) aired immediately after this episode, making it the first time two episodes aired on the same day and also the shortest time gap between two episodes. — Fun fact: Sky1 in United Kingdom and Ireland, and Channel Ten in Australia didn't air Nationals on the same day as Props. — This is the first episode to be directed by series creator Ian Brennan. — With the exception of the headband, the outfit that Tina wears as Rachel is similar to the one Rachel wore in the bathroom scene in The Rhodes Not Taken (01x05). — Mike Chang's full name is revealed to be Michael Robert Chang. — This is the second time this season (out of 3) where there is a car driving scene, preceded by Quinn in On My Way (03x14) and followed by Rachel and Finn in Goodbye (03x22). — In Preggers (01x04), Puck said that he could wear a dress to school and people would think that it was cool. In this episode, he does actually wear a dress to school (ironically not getting the reception he intended, though). Some cultural references: - 1. Mercedes and Brittany mention the 2012 film 21 Jump Street, starring Channing Tatum and Jonah Hill. 21 Jump Street actually makes a reference to Glee in which Tatum's character says "F*ck you, Glee." - 2. It should also be noted that Harry Shum Jr. had previously starred in the 2008 film Step Up 2 the Streets in which Tatum was featured in. - 3. Mike Chang had also told Santa in "A Very Glee Christmas" that he wished Channing Tatum would "stop being in stuff." - 4. Freaky Friday is mentioned in this episode by Tina when she is explaining why she wants to help Rachel, and the movie is again mentioned in Nationals (03x21) by Lindsay Lohan herself. MISTAKES: * In the "Props" preview, as Tina stands up in the fountain you can see that she's wearing tan pants, but when the camera angle switches to the front she's wearing a black skirt again. In the actual episode, this error was fixed. * During the car scene with Tina and Rachel, Lea Michele's wrist tattoo is visible. * Puck states to Beiste that his father had been AWOL since he was 10 although in Choke, he states to Finn and the boys that he hadn't seen him in 5 years. Since Puck is roughly 17-18, his 5 years prior would have only placed him at 12–13 years of age. This can be considered a small continuity error. * Also, after Tina fell in the fountain, when Blaine and Kurt (Puck and Finn) were talking you can see Tina's headband and when the camera angle switched there was no more headband. This happened several times. * When Will and Sue are discussing the Nationals set list, Tina's and Quinn's name are both in the Troubletones performance of Edge of Glory, yet they weren't placed into that performance until Nationals. Sugar and Brittany are listed as soloists even though they though don't sing one. * The word 'performed' is misspelled as 'perfromed' at the bottom of the set list. * When Cooter pushes everything off the table, the knife flies off the table and there is a napkin is the center of the table. In the next shot the knife is back to its original place and the napkin is on the edge of the table. * During the "Jersey Shore"-spoof, Blaine has his arms crossed during the close-up view of him and Kurt. Then, after the angle changes, Blaine has his arms widened out only a millisecond later. * During the body switching scenes, most of the characters' have continuity in their respective clothing choices. However, Rachel (as Tina) is not depicted sporting Tina's "sixties swinging London" style, but rather her goth-punk style from Season One and Two. This is probably because Rachel currently wears clothes similar to Tina's. * Before Mr. Schuester writes Nationals on the board, there is a close up of Tina, depicting her as angry, but when the scene immediately changes, she's happy, then back to angry again. * When Rachel is talking to Tina about solos, she asks Tina if she has a Twitter or Facebook account, and precedes to say that she doesn't. However, in Saturday Night Glee-ver, she tweeted for "the one that I'm engaged to" to come to the auditorium, meaning that she has a Twitter account. * In Mattress (01x12), Rachel reveals that she is part of just about every single club at McKinley High. However, in The Purple Piano Project (03x01), she claims that like Kurt, she is thin on extra-curricular activities and picks up the idea of putting on West Side Story. In Asian F (03x03), she runs against Kurt and Brittany for class president because she feels she has not been involved in enough activities to secure herself a spot for NYADA. If Rachel really was involved in all those clubs she mentioned in Mattress, she would not have needed to run for class president. Also, Shelby even read Rachel's resume in Mash Off (03x06) and says "I feel sorry for the people who don't have these big-ticket items on THEIR resume." However, it could just be that Rachel is so worried that she sees what she has already done as not enough, and she feels like she always needs more to go on her CV. Also, in Props, when Rachel is telling Tina that she deserves the solo for Nationals, she also tells her that she is involved in over seventeen extra curricular activities. * In Pilot (01x01), Mercedes is assigned by Finn to take care of the costumes. However, since the end of that episode, the costume committee hasn't been heard from or seen until Props, where it is revealed that Tina, Sugar, Joe, and Rory are assigned to it by Mr. Schuester. However, Finn was not in a place to assign permanent roles to member of the Glee Club, and 3 years had passed in between the 2 episodes. During “Because You Loved Me”, Sugar (as Quinn) is not seen in the choir room when Tina first starts singing the song, but is seen in the auditorium and back in the choir room when the song ends.
